Transfer News: Chelsea leading the race to sign AS Monaco midfielder Aurélien Tchouaméni

According to Marca via Sport Witness (h/t Mirror), Chelsea are in pole position to sign 21-year-old French midfielder Aurélien Tchouaméni

The French international has been grabbing interest from giants across Europe recently. The youngster is being linked to teams like Real Madrid, Manchester United, and Chelsea. However, it is believed that the Blues are frontrunners n pursuit of the 21-year-old.

The young midfielder has already played 65 matches across all competitions for AS Monaco. During that period he has scored 5 goals and provided 4 assists for the French club. The West London club is enjoying the season whilst currently sitting on the top of the Premier League table with 26 points after 11 matches.

Chelsea are in pole position to sign Aurélien Tchouaméni

They went on to splurge £97.5 million for Romelu Lukaku in the last transfer window and could be looking to add some reinforcement in the middle of the pitch this time around. Mateo Kovacic, N’Golo Kante, and Jorginho are the midfield trio that is usually preferred by Thomas Tuchel. They also managed to get Saul Niguez on loan from Atletico Madrid for the season.

Kante isn’t getting younger by the day and Chelsea should look to future-proof their midfield sooner rather than later. Tchouaméni perfectly fits the bill and could become a great long-term asset for the club, if developed and nurtured properly.

Chelsea play across several competitions during the campaign and his acquisition could help the Blues compete at a higher level. The 21-year-old could take some time to get used to the intensity and physicality of the PL but could go on to develop further under a world-renowned coach like Tuchel.

Aurelien Tchouameni is one of the hottest prospects in Ligue 1. (imago Images)

According to a recent report by Football.London via Sport Witness on 10th November, The French club has evaluated him at €50m (£42m). A previous piece by Daily Mail at the start of October suggested that Monaco had slapped a £34m price stage on the 21-year-old.

With increasing competition, the Ligue 1 club could be tempted to increase their selling price till January. This could make his purchase an expensive affair but Chelsea haven’t shied away from spending the big bucks when it comes to bringing in supremely talented players to the club.
